Thanks, done. --------------------------------------------------------------------------- Tom Lane wrote: > TODO has an entry > > o Allow UPDATE to handle complex aggregates [update]? > > which I think is now obsolete, because we've settled on rejecting > aggregates at the top level of UPDATE, as the spec tells us to do. > > Also, there's one remaining unfinished feature in the multi-argument > aggregate patch, which I think we should have a TODO item for: > > * Allow DISTINCT to work in multiple-argument aggregate calls > > The SQL2003 spec doesn't require this (it forbids DISTINCT in all its > two-argument aggregates) but it seems like we should do it someday > for orthogonality's sake. > > regards, tom lane -- Bruce Momjian bruce@momjian.us EnterpriseDB http://www.enterprisedb.com + If your life is a hard drive, Christ can be your backup. +
